CVE-2020-25695

54
FAUCET Score

CVE-2020-25695 is a high-severity privilege escalation flaw affecting PostgreSQL versions prior to 13.1, 12.5, 11.10, 10.15, 9.6.20, and 9.5.24. An authenticated attacker with object creation permissions in any schema can execute arbitrary SQL functions as a superuser, leading to significant impacts on data confidentiality, integrity, and system availability. With a CVSS score of 8.8, this vulnerability is easily exploitable over the network with low privileges and no user interaction. While no public exploit code is currently available in Metasploit, Nuclei, or ExploitDB, it has garnered some community discussion and media coverage, indicating awareness within the cybersecurity landscape.

Vendor Advisories (2)

redhatCVE-2020-25695Important

postgresql: Multiple features escape "security restricted operation" sandbox

Nov 12, 2020
microsoft2020-Nov/CVE-2020-25695Important

A flaw was found in PostgreSQL versions before 13.1 before 12.5 before 11.10 before 10.15 before 9.6.20 and before 9.5.24. An attacker having permission to create non-temporary objects in at least one schema can execute arbitrary SQL functions under the identity of a superuser. The highest threat from this vulnerability is to data confidentiality and integrity as well as system availability.
